Back to Question Center
0

الحصول على بوتستراب علامات التبويب للعب لطيفة مع البناء الحصول على بوتستراب علامات التبويب للعب لطيفة مع البناء المواضيع ذات الصلة: هتمل قماش & أمب؛ Semalt

1 answers:
الحصول على بوتستراب علامات التبويب للعب لطيفة مع البناء

سيمالت هي واحدة من الأطر الأكثر اعتماد على نطاق واسع، مفتوحة المصدر، الأمامية. تضمين سيمالت في المشروع الخاص بك، وعليك أن تكون قادرا على سحق صفحات الويب استجابة في أي وقت من الأوقات. إذا كنت قد حاولت استخدام البناء جنبا إلى جنب مع القطعة سيمالت علامات التبويب، واحدة من العديد من مكونات جافا سكريبت سيمالت لهذا العرض، وهناك احتمالات كنت قد تعثرت على نوع من السلوك المزعج.

على موقع سيمالت، نقرأ أن سيمالت هو - imagenes de personas profesionistas.

مكتبة تخطيط شبكة سيمالت. وهو يعمل عن طريق وضع عناصر في الوضع الأمثل على أساس المساحة العمودية المتاحة، نوع من مثل الحجارة ميسون المناسب في الجدار.

فعلت، وهذا المقال يسلط الضوء على ما هي القضية وما يمكنك القيام به لحلها.

شرح علامات التبويب بوتستراب

يتضمن مكون علامات التبويب بوتستراب مفتاحين، القطع ذات الصلة: عنصر التنقل المبوب وعدد من لوحات المحتوى. عند تحميل الصفحة، تحتوي اللوحة الأولى على الفئة . نشط تطبيقها على ذلك. وهذا يتيح لوحة لتكون مرئية بشكل افتراضي. يتم استخدام هذه الفئة عبر جافا سكريبت لتبديل رؤية اللوحة عبر الأحداث التي يتم تشغيلها بواسطة روابط التنقل المبوبة: إذا . نشط هو موجود لوحة مرئيا، وإلا لوحة مخفية.

إذا كان لديك بعض المحتوى على شبكة الإنترنت التي قدمت أفضل في قطع الفردية، بدلا من مكتظة في كل بقعة واحدة، قد يكون مكون علامات التبويب سيمالت في متناول اليدين.

لماذا البناء؟

في بعض الحالات، المحتوى داخل كل لوحة مناسبة ليتم عرضها في تخطيط الشبكة استجابة. على سبيل المثال، مجموعة من المنتجات والخدمات، وعناصر الحافظة هي أنواع من المحتويات التي يمكن عرضها في شكل الشبكة.

سيمالت، إذا خلايا الشبكة ليست من نفس الارتفاع، شيء مثل ما تراه أدناه يمكن أن يحدث.

<إمغ سرك = "/ إمغ / 8b6ac70fcb0028bab6a2da2ca142c6fe0. جبغ" ألت = "الحصول على بوتستراب علامات التبويب للعب لطيفة مع البناءالحصول على بوتستراب علامات التبويب للعب لطيفة مع ماسونريلاتد المواضيع: هتملكانفاس و سيمالت "/>

فجوة واسعة يفصل بين صفين من المحتوى ويظهر تخطيط مكسورة.

في الوقت الحاضر، بوتستراب يحل قضية متساوية العرض مع العلامة التجارية الجديدة مكون البطاقة، والذي يقوم على فليكسبوكس. فقط إضافة بطاقة سطح السفينة فئة إلى مجموعة من مكونات بطاقة كافية لتحقيق أعمدة متساوية العرض.

إذا كنت تريد البطاقات الخاصة بك لتكون من طول متفاوتة، هل يمكن استخدام CSS3 متعدد تخطيط العمود. (بعد كل شيء، على الرغم من أن هناك بعض الأخطاء دعم المتصفح، وعموما انها جيدة جدا.) وهذا يكمن الخيار أعمدة بطاقة جديدة التي تأتي تعبئتها مع عنصر البطاقة. ومع ذلك، إذا كنت لا تزال تحب الرسوم المتحركة لطيفة أن مكتبة ماسونري سيمالت يوفر من خارج منطقة الجزاء، والتوافق متصفح واسع، سيمالت لا يزال خيارا قابلا للتطبيق في هذه الحالة.

إعداد صفحة تجريبية

الحصول على صفحة تجريبية وتشغيلها يساعد على إظهار كيفية دمج علامات التبويب بوتستراب مع سيمالت ليست واضحة كما يمكن للمرء أن يتوقع.

تستند صفحة العرض هذه المقالة على قالب بداية، المتاحة على موقع سيمالت. تمثل قيمة السمة هريف العلاقة بين علامة تبويب واحدة والمحتوى المقابل لها. على سبيل المثال، قيمة هريف من #home تخلق علاقة مع المحتوى المبوب ب إد = "هوم" : النقر فوق علامة تبويب معينة يكشف محتويات داخل ديف مع معرف قيمة منزل .

أيضا، لاحظ كيف بوتستراب تولي اهتماما لسمات إمكانية الوصول مثل دور ، أريا الضوابط ، الخ

سيمالت مقتطف الشفرة لتوضيح بنية المحتوى المبوب:

   <ديف كلاس = "تاب-بين فاد شو أكتيف" إد = "هوم" رول = "تابانيل" أريا-لابيلدبي = "هوم-تاب">

علامة التبويب 1 المحتوى

<ديف كلاس = "كارد-غروب"><ديف كلاس = "كارد"><إمغ كلاس = "كارد-إمغ-توب" سرك = "باث / تو / إمغ" ألت = "غطاء صورة البطاقة"><ديف كلاس = "كارد-بودي">
عنوان البطاقة

نص البطاقة هنا.

<سمال كلاس = "تكست-موتد"> آخر تحديث قبل 3 دقائق

<ديف كلاس = "كارد"><ديف كلاس = "كارد">

ما عليك سوى إضافة بنية مماثلة لكل قسم محتوى مبوب يطابق عناصر علامات التبويب التي تم إختيارها أعلاه.

للحصول على رمز كامل، راجع التجريبي سيمالت.

إضافة مكتبة البناء

يمكنك تحميل البناء من الموقع الرسمي من خلال النقر على تحميل البناء. pkgd. دقيقة. جس زر.

لتجنب مشاكل التخطيط، يوصي المؤلف المكتبة باستخدام البناء جنبا إلى جنب مع إيماجيسسمالت المساعد.

البناء لا يحتاج إلى مكتبة جسمالت للعمل. ومع ذلك، لأن مكونات جافا سكريبت بوتستراب بالفعل استخدام جسيمالت، سأكون جعل الحياة أسهل لنفسي وتهيئة البناء الطريق جسيمالت.

وإليك مقتطف الشفرة لتهيئة البناء باستخدام مسج والصور إيماجيسلوادد:

     فار $ كونتينر = $ ('. ماسونري-كونتينر')؛$ الحاوية. إيماجيسلوادد (فونكتيون    {$ الحاوية. البناء ({عرض العمود: '. بطاقة'،إيتمسليكتور: '. بطاقة'})؛})؛    

رمز أعلاه يخزن ديف أن يلتف جميع عناصر البطاقة في متغير يسمى حاوية $ .

بعد ذلك، يتم تهيئة البناء على حاوية $ مع اثنين من الخيارات الموصى بها. ويشير الخيار للعمود إلى عرض عمود من الشبكة الأفقية. هنا يتم تعيينها على عرض عنصر بطاقة واحدة باستخدام اسم الفئة. يشير الخيار إيتمسلكتور إلى العناصر الفرعية التي سيتم استخدامها كعنصر عناصر. هنا، يتم تعيينه أيضا إلى عنصر بطاقة واحدة.

سيمالت الآن الوقت لاختبار التعليمات البرمجية.

عفوا! ما الأمر مع لوحات مخفية؟

على صفحة الويب التي لا تستخدم علامات التبويب بوتستراب، رمز أعلاه يعمل مثل سحر. سيمالت، في هذه الحالة، كنت قريبا ندرك نوع من السلوك مضحك يحدث.

سيمالت، يبدو على ما يرام لأن الشبكة داخل لوحة علامة التبويب النشطة الافتراضية يتم عرضها بشكل صحيح:

<إمغ سرك = "/ إمغ / 8b6ac70fcb0028bab6a2da2ca142c6fe1. جبغ" ألت = "الحصول على بوتستراب علامات التبويب للعب لطيفة مع البناءالحصول على بوتستراب علامات التبويب للعب لطيفة مع ماسونريلاتد المواضيع: هتملكانفاس و سيمالت "/>

سيمالت، إذا نقرت على رابط التنقل المبوب للكشف عن محتوى اللوحة المخفية، وهنا ما يحدث:

<إمغ سرك = "/ إمغ / c81f9b60c054b6e651d64ddea69397de2.

وهذا ليس كل شيء. سيمالت نافذة المتصفح يسبب عناصر الشبكة لوضع أنفسهم بشكل صحيح.

دعونا إصلاح علة تخطيط

منذ علة تخطيط غير متوقع يصبح واضحا بعد النقر على رابط الملاحة مبوب، دعونا ننظر إلى الأحداث التي أطلقتها سيمالت علامات التبويب أكثر قليلا عن كثب.

قائمة الأحداث قصيرة جدا. ها هو.

  • . الإفطار. الحرائق على علامة التبويب تظهر، ولكن قبل أن يتم عرض علامة التبويب الجديدة
  • . الإفطار. الحرائق على علامة التبويب تظهر بعد أن تم عرض علامة التبويب
  • إخفاء. الإفطار. عند ظهور علامة تبويب جديدة (وبالتالي يجب أن تكون علامة التبويب النشطة السابقة مخفية)
  • مخبأة. الإفطار. حرائق بعد عرض علامة تبويب جديدة (وبالتالي يتم إخفاء علامة التبويب النشطة السابقة).

لأن التخطيط البناء يحصل فوضى بعد عرض علامة التبويب، انتقل ل هو مبين. الإفطار. علامة التبويب الحدث. إليك الرمز الذي يمكنك وضعه أسفل المقتطف السابق:

     $ ('a [داتا-توغل = تاب]'). كل (فونكتيون    {فار $ ذيس = $ (ذيس)؛$ هذا. أون ('شون. بس. تاب'، فونكتيون    {$ الحاوية. إيماجيسلوادد (فونكتيون    {$ الحاوية. البناء ({عرض العمود: '. بطاقة'،إيتمسليكتور: '. بطاقة'})؛})؛})؛})؛    

سيمالت ما يحدث في الكود أعلاه:

جكري . كل الحلقات وظيفة على كل رابط تابد الملاحة ويستمع ل هو مبين. الإفطار. علامة التبويب الحدث. كما حريق الحدث، لوحة يصبح مرئيا، وإعادة تهيئة البناء بعد الانتهاء من جميع الصور تحميل.

اختبار المدونة

إذا كنت قد تم متابعة على طول، إطلاق التجريبي الخاص بك في المتصفح، أو محاولة الخروج من سيمالت التجريبي أدناه للتحقق من النتيجة:

انظر علامات التبويب بين بوتستراب و ماسونيري بواسطة سيتيبوانت (SitePoint) على كوديبين.

انقر على رابط التنقل المبوب ولاحظ كيف، هذه المرة، عناصر الشبكة تناسب بالتساوي داخل كل لوحة المحتوى. سيمالت المتصفح يسبب العناصر لإعادة وضعها بشكل صحيح مع تأثير الرسوم المتحركة لطيفة.

سيمالت ذلك، المهمة!

الاستنتاج

في هذه المقالة، لقد أظهرت كيفية دمج مكون علامات التبويب بوتستراب مع مكتبة البناء سيمالت.

كل من البرامج النصية هي سهلة الاستخدام وقوية جدا. ومع ذلك، ووضعها معا، وسوف تواجه بعض الأخطاء تخطيط مزعج التي تؤثر على علامات التبويب المخفية. كما هو مبين أعلاه، الحيلة هي إعادة تهيئة مكتبة سيمالت بعد أن تصبح كل لوحة مرئية.

مع هذا الحل في الأدوات الخاصة بك، وتحقيق تخطيطات البلاط كبيرة سيكون نسيم.

سعيد بوتسترابينغ!

إذا كنت قد حصلت على أساسيات بوتستراب تحت حزام الخاص بك ولكن يتساءلون كيفية اتخاذ المهارات بوتستراب الخاص بك إلى المستوى التالي، تحقق من بناء موقع الويب الخاص بك الأول مع دورة بوتستراب 4 لإدخال سريعة وممتعة إلى قوة بوتستراب.

March 1, 2018